Output 26a8ecedef7c6077a5c58cd21c9f5201c2d87baf836a605654ccd286ee6f2fc9:5

value
49820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73e419c3ad7b5b4ed996b30778c3c91533cfa578 OP_EQUAL
address
3CFntKCw59r3wPqE5q6ZEZYf5nAwgeRCh2
transaction
26a8ecedef7c6077a5c58cd21c9f5201c2d87baf836a605654ccd286ee6f2fc9
spent
true